1. Open https://console.cloud.google.com/ and create a new project (e.g. `autoacct`).
|
||||
2. In the top search bar, search **Google Sheets API** → click the result → **Enable**.
|
||||
3. Left menu: **IAM & Admin → Service Accounts → + Create Service Account**
|
||||
- Name: `bookkeeping` (any name works)
|
||||
- Click **Create and Continue → Done** (skip the optional role step).
|
||||
4. Click the new service account → **Keys** tab → **Add Key → Create new key → JSON → Create**.
|
||||
A `.json` key file will download to your browser's Downloads folder.
|
||||
5. **Copy the service account's email** (looks like `bookkeeping@<project>.iam.gserviceaccount.com`) — you'll paste it in Step 4.

### Step 3 — Move the key file out of the repo
|
||||
|
||||
Never leave a service-account key inside the repo directory. Move it to `~/.config/gcp/`: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
mkdir -p ~/.config/gcp
|
||||
mv ~/Downloads/<your-downloaded-file>.json ~/.config/gcp/bookkeeping-sa.json
|
||||
chmod 600 ~/.config/gcp/bookkeeping-sa.json
|
||||
```

### Step 4 — Create the Google Sheet
|
||||
|
||||
1. Open https://sheets.new (creates a fresh blank sheet).
|
||||
2. Give it a title (e.g. `AutoACCT Expenses`).
|
||||
3. **Note the tab name** at the bottom-left — default is `Sheet1` (English UI) or `工作表1` (Chinese UI). Write it down, you'll need the exact string in Step 5.
|
||||
4. Click cell **A1**, then paste this one line (the tabs split the headers across A–N automatically):
|
||||
```
|
||||
Date Merchant Category Amount Currency Amount (HKD) FX Rate FX Date Payment Method Line Items Raw OCR Note Receipt Logged At
|
||||
```
|
||||
5. Click **Share** (top right) → paste the service-account email from Step 2 → role **Editor** → **Send** (you can uncheck "Notify people").
|
||||
6. Copy the **Sheet ID** from the URL — it's the long string between `/d/` and `/edit`:
|
||||
`https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/`**`1abc...xyz`**`/edit`

### Step 5 — Write config.json
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
cd ~/.claude/skills/bookkeeping
|
||||
cp config.example.json config.json
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Open `config.json` in your editor and fill in **sheet_id** and **worksheet** with the values from Step 4:
|
||||
|
||||
```json
|
||||
{
|
||||
"sheet_id": "1abc...xyz",
|
||||
"worksheet": "Sheet1",
|
||||
"service_account_path": "~/.config/gcp/bookkeeping-sa.json",
|
||||
"hkd_fx_provider": "frankfurter"
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
> ⚠️ **Common pitfall**: if your Google Sheets UI is in Chinese, the default tab is named `工作表1` (not `Sheet1`). Put `"worksheet": "工作表1"` exactly. A mismatched tab name throws `HTTP 400: Unable to parse range`.
|
||||
|
||||
### Step 6 — Sanity check
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
echo '{"date":"2026-04-20","merchant":"TEST","category":"Other","amount":1,"currency":"HKD","amount_hkd":1,"fx_rate":1,"fx_date":"2026-04-20"}' | python3 ~/.claude/skills/bookkeeping/scripts/append_row.py
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Success looks like: `OK 'Sheet1'!A2:N2` and a new row appears in the sheet. Delete the TEST row when you're done.
